Output 5072e089e1134a5d8f0fa4a8cb9848914a856fc6b5f6283695622127e80e2b79:50

value
3352606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c662c14d518ed7b57a0742e4161df86720d74c7 OP_EQUAL
address
34HBExqCj3A6HhoegfLVgckWLvVN1NqE5B
transaction
5072e089e1134a5d8f0fa4a8cb9848914a856fc6b5f6283695622127e80e2b79
spent
true